Why isn't Roku Ulta 2018 model not connecting to 5 ghz?

Jump to solution

I have Roku Ulta 2018 model which is suppose to be dual band. I cannot seem to get it to connect to 5 ghz and as a result the mbps keeps fluctuating to as low as 9 mbps. Is this suppose to happen. None of my other devices has issues finding 5 ghz? Any solutions please. I have T-Mobil Internet and SlingTV.

Re: Why isn't Roku Ulta 2018 model not connecting to 5 ghz?

Jump to solution

If your router is using one of the DFS channels that the Roku can't use, Roku won't even know it's there.  On those other devices (phone, whatever) that connect to the 5 GHz band, what channel do they say is being used?

Another thing that may come into play is that some people find their Rokus always connect to the 2.4 GHz band when the router uses the same network name (SSID) for both bands.  If your router allows you to name these bands separately you can always choose which one to connect to.

This MIGHT be your problem.

The nine 5 GHz channels supported by Roku devices are 36, 40, 44, 48, 149, 153, 157, 161, and 165. 

The channels assigned to the 5 GHz band in ranges 50-64 and 100-144 are shared with other uses such as military, radar, and weather. These channels are termed DFS (dynamic frequency selection) channels and routers are supposed to automatically switch to a different channel if they detect one of these channels is in use in your area.Roku and many other home use devices avoid this whole issue by not supporting these DFS channels.   

Many home routers don't include DFS channels, but some do.  Make sure your router is not using these DFS channels, and that it is not using an auto select option that could choose a DFS channel.
